About this listen

The PMP exam is the golden standard for project management professionals, but let's face it - it's tough to stay conscious when reading the PMBOK. To help you prepare for the test, this audiobook provides over 2,600 questions, covering all 10 knowledge areas. Best of all, it has been updated for the PMBOK Guide Sixth Edition, which includes all sorts of greatness over the previous edition, including the following changes:

  • An updated PMI's Talent Triangle
  • A focus on schedule instead of time
  • Three new processes have been added
  • One process has been removed
  • Monitor is the new control
  • An increase in the number of ITTOs
  • A recognition that agile methodologies now rule the planet

The material is presented in three different formats:

  1. Given a question, provide the correct answer
  2. Given a term, provide the correct definition
  3. Given a definition, provide the correct term

Enjoy a just-the-facts-please method for learning the PMP material and pass the exam on the first try!

Note: This audiobook is not a substitute for a tutorial on the PMP exam material. It will, however, make sure you remember the material when you walk in for the exam. Before using this audiobook, you should go over the material using an exhaustive guide, such as Simple PMP Exam Guide.
